A wand massager is a versatile and powerful tool designed to provide targeted relief for muscle tension and promote relaxation. These handheld devices are characterized by their long handles and large, rounded heads, which allow for easy maneuverability and effective application of pressure to various areas of the body. Whether you’re dealing with chronic pain, post-workout soreness, or simply seeking a way to unwind after a long day, a wand massager can be an invaluable addition to your self-care routine.The benefits of using a wand massager extend beyond mere muscle relief. These devices can enhance blood circulation, reduce stress levels, and even improve flexibility by loosening tight muscles.
Many users find that incorporating a wand massager into their regular wellness practices not only alleviates physical discomfort but also contributes to an overall sense of well-being. The soothing vibrations can help release endorphins, the body’s natural painkillers, making it an effective tool for both physical and mental health.Understanding how wand massagers work is essential for maximizing their benefits. Most models operate using powerful vibrations generated by an electric motor or batteries, which can penetrate deep into muscle tissue. This vibration therapy stimulates the nerves and muscles, promoting relaxation and reducing tension.
Users can typically adjust the intensity and speed settings to customize their experience, allowing for a gentle massage or a more vigorous treatment depending on their needs. With various attachments available for different types of massage, wand massagers offer a tailored approach to self-care that can cater to individual preferences.
Types of Wand Massagers
When exploring the world of wand massagers, it's essential to understand the different types available, as each offers unique benefits tailored to various needs. The two primary categories are electric wand massagers and battery-operated wand massagers , each with distinct features that cater to different preferences.Electric Wand Massagers
Electric wand massagers are designed to be plugged into a power outlet, providing a consistent and powerful source of vibration. Here are some key features:- Consistent Power: Since they rely on electricity, these massagers deliver a steady level of intensity, making them ideal for deep tissue massage.
- Variety of Settings: Many electric models come equipped with multiple speed and intensity settings, allowing users to customize their experience based on their comfort level.
- Longer Usage Time: As long as they are plugged in, electric wand massagers can be used for extended periods without the need for recharging or changing batteries.
Battery-Operated Wand Massagers
On the other hand, battery-operated wand massagers offer portability and convenience.Here’s what you can expect from these devices:
- Portability: These massagers are lightweight and easy to carry, making them perfect for travel or use in various locations around the home.
- Rechargeable Options: Many modern battery-operated models come with rechargeable batteries, eliminating the need for constant battery replacements and making them more environmentally friendly.
- Diverse Vibration Patterns: Battery-operated wand massagers often feature a range of vibration patterns and intensities, allowing users to explore different sensations and find what works best for them.

Tips for Effective Use of Wand Massagers
Using a wand massager effectively can significantly enhance your relaxation and muscle relief experience. Here are some practical tips and techniques to help you maximize the benefits of your wand massager while ensuring safety during use.Understanding Intensity Levels
One of the first things to consider when using a wand massager is the intensity level. Most devices come with multiple settings, allowing you to adjust the vibration strength according to your comfort level.Start with a lower setting to allow your body to acclimate to the sensations. Gradually increase the intensity as needed, especially if you are targeting areas with more tension or soreness.
Targeting Specific Areas
Wand massagers are designed for versatility, making them suitable for various muscle groups. Here are some common areas where you can apply the wand:- Neck and Shoulders: Use gentle, circular motions to relieve tension in these areas. Focus on spots that feel tight or knotted.
- Back: Glide the wand along your spine and lower back, applying more pressure on sore spots.
- Legs and Feet: For tired legs, move the wand from your thighs down to your calves and feet, using long strokes for relaxation.
Experimenting with Techniques
Different techniques can yield varying results.Here are a few methods to try:
- Circular Motions: This technique is effective for loosening tight muscles. Move the wand in small circles over the targeted area.
- Long Strokes: For larger muscle groups, use long, sweeping motions along the length of the muscle.
- Pulsing: Instead of continuous pressure, try pulsing the wand on specific points for a more intense release.
Safety Precautions
While wand massagers are generally safe, it’s essential to follow certain precautions to avoid injury:- Avoid Sensitive Areas: Do not use the massager on sensitive areas such as the face or near open wounds.
- Keep Hair Away: Ensure that long hair is tied back to prevent it from getting caught in the device.
- Listen to Your Body: If you experience any pain or discomfort, stop using the device immediately and reassess your technique or intensity level.

How do I clean my wand massager?
Cleaning your wand massager is essential for hygiene. Here’s how to do it:- Unplug the device if it’s electric or remove batteries if applicable.
- Use a damp cloth with mild soap to wipe down the exterior.
- Avoid submerging the device in water unless it is specifically designed to be waterproof.
- Ensure it is completely dry before storing or using again.
